11 As I swore in my anger, ‘They will never enter my rest!’”[a]

12 See to it,[b] brothers and sisters,[c] that none of you has[d] an evil, unbelieving heart that forsakes[e] the living God.[f] 13 But exhort one another each day, as long as it is called “Today,” that none of you may become hardened by sin’s deception.

Footnotes

  1. Hebrews 3:11 tn Grk “if they shall enter my rest,” a Hebrew idiom expressing an oath that something will certainly not happen.
  2. Hebrews 3:12 tn Or “take care.”
  3. Hebrews 3:12 tn Grk “brothers.” See note on the phrase “brothers and sisters” in 2:11.
  4. Hebrews 3:12 tn Grk “that there not be in any of you.”
  5. Hebrews 3:12 tn Or “deserts,” “rebels against.”
  6. Hebrews 3:12 tn Grk “in forsaking the living God.”
